Female Murder Suspect Arrested in Simi Valley

Jail records indicate that a woman who police were looking to question in relation to a recent murder in Riverside County was located and arrested in Simi Valley on Wednesday

The Simi Valley Police Department helped to make the arrest of a Riverside County woman Wednesday, who was sought by the city of Beaumont in connection with the slaying of a 44-year-old woman who was found dead on February 28.

Vanessa Kathleen Fierro, who was sought by Beaumont police for questioning in the murder of a 44-year-old local woman, has been arrested, jail records indicate.

Beaumont police say Fierro has been booked on a charge of murder in the death of a local woman.

According to police spokeswoman Darci Mulvihill, Fierro was located in Simi Valley, thanks to several leads they were given.

"Detectives immediately began following up on several leads and determined that Fierro was in Simi Valley," Mulvihill said.  "Fierro was located in the 1900 block of Stowe Street in Simi Valley and taken into custody with the assistance of the Simi Valley Police Department."

Bail has been set at one million dollars for Fierro, a convicted felon.

As for what Fierro's connection to Simi Valley is, police said they could not immediately disclose that information, due to the ongoing investigation.

Beaumont police had said Fierro was the roommate of murder victim Elizabeth "Coti"Asselin, and when she was found dead Feb. 28, she was named a "person of interest" in the case.
